1. Introduction
The Transcend MTS400 256GB M.2 SATA III Solid State Drive is designed to enhance the speed and capacity of compatible computing devices. Featuring a compact 42mm M.2 form factor and MLC NAND Flash memory, this SSD offers reliable performance with read speeds up to 560MB/s and write speeds up to 320MB/s. It is ideal for ultrabooks, tablets, and other compact systems requiring a significant storage upgrade.

4. Specifications
| Feature | Description |
|---|---|
| Model Number | TS256GMTS400 |
| Capacity | 256 GB |
| Interface | SATA III 6Gb/s |
| Form Factor | M.2 2242 (42mm) |
| Flash Type | MLC NAND Flash |
| Max Read Speed | Up to 560 MB/s |
| Max Write Speed | Up to 320 MB/s |
| Dimensions (LxWxH) | 1.65 x 0.14 x 0.87 inches (42 x 3.5 x 22 mm) |
| Weight | 0.32 ounces (9 g) |
| Operating System Support | Windows XP/Vista/7/8 or Linux Kernel 2.6.31, or later |
| Special Features | Power Shield, Dev Sleep mode, DDR3 DRAM cache, S.M.A.R.T., TRIM, NCQ, RoHS compliant |
5. Setup and Installation
5.1. Pre-Installation Checklist
- Compatibility: Ensure your device has an available M.2 slot that supports SATA-based M.2 SSDs (specifically the 2242 form factor). M.2 NVMe and M.2 SATA drives are not interchangeable at the protocol level.
- Backup: Back up all important data from your existing storage drive before proceeding.
- Tools: You may need a small Phillips-head screwdriver and possibly an anti-static wrist strap.
- Power Off: Completely shut down your computer and disconnect all power cables.
5.2. Physical Installation (Desktop/Laptop)
The installation process varies slightly between desktops and laptops. Refer to your device's manual for specific instructions on accessing the M.2 slot.
- Open your computer case or laptop's back panel.
- Locate the M.2 slot on your motherboard. It typically has a small screw at the end.
- Carefully insert the Transcend MTS400 SSD into the M.2 slot at a slight angle (approximately 30 degrees). The gold contacts should slide in smoothly.
- Gently press the SSD down until it is parallel with the motherboard.
- Secure the SSD with the small screw provided with your motherboard or device.

5.3. Software Setup (Windows)
After physical installation, you need to initialize and format the new SSD for your operating system to recognize and use it.
- Reconnect power and turn on your computer.
- Open Disk Management: Right-click the Start button, then select 'Disk Management'.
- You should see your new SSD listed as 'Disk [number]' and marked as 'Unallocated'.
- Right-click on the unallocated space of your new SSD and select 'New Simple Volume'.
- Follow the New Simple Volume Wizard to assign a drive letter and format the drive. It is recommended to use the NTFS file system.
- Once formatted, the SSD will be ready for use.

7. Maintenance
To ensure the longevity and optimal performance of your Transcend MTS400 SSD, consider the following maintenance tips:
- TRIM Support: Ensure your operating system has TRIM enabled. TRIM helps the SSD maintain its performance over time by efficiently managing data blocks. Most modern operating systems (Windows 7 and later, Linux kernels 2.6.31 and later) support TRIM automatically.
- S.M.A.R.T. Monitoring: Utilize S.M.A.R.T. (Self-Monitoring, Analysis, and Reporting Technology) tools to monitor the health and status of your SSD.
- Firmware Updates: Periodically check the Transcend website for any available firmware updates for your SSD model. Firmware updates can improve performance, stability, and compatibility.
- Avoid Overfilling: While SSDs perform well even when nearly full, leaving some free space (e.g., 10-15%) can help maintain optimal performance and extend lifespan.
- Power Shield: The MTS400 supports Power Shield, which helps prevent data loss during sudden power outages. Ensure your system's power supply is stable.
8. Troubleshooting
8.1. Drive Not Detected
- Check Connections: Ensure the SSD is correctly seated in the M.2 slot and the mounting screw is secure.
- BIOS/UEFI Settings: Enter your system's BIOS/UEFI settings (usually by pressing Del, F2, F10, or F12 during boot-up). Verify that the M.2 slot is enabled and configured correctly (e.g., SATA mode).
- Compatibility: Double-check that your motherboard's M.2 slot supports SATA-based M.2 SSDs. Some slots are NVMe-only.
- Try Another Slot/Device: If available, test the SSD in a different M.2 slot or another compatible device to rule out a faulty SSD.
8.2. Initialization/Formatting Issues
- Disk Management: Ensure you are using Windows Disk Management (or an equivalent tool in Linux) to initialize and format the drive.
- Online Status: In Disk Management, if the drive is listed as 'Offline', right-click it and select 'Online'.
- Rescan Disks: In Disk Management, go to 'Action' > 'Rescan Disks' to refresh the view.
8.3. Slow Performance
- TRIM Enabled: Verify that TRIM is enabled in your operating system.
- Firmware: Check for and install any available firmware updates for the SSD.
- SATA III Port: Ensure the SSD is connected to a SATA III (6Gb/s) compatible M.2 slot for maximum speed.
- Driver Updates: Ensure your motherboard's chipset drivers are up to date.
